X-Ray Envelopes Market - Global Forecast 2026-2032

The X-Ray Envelopes Market size was estimated at USD 470.40 million in 2025 and expected to reach USD 496.31 million in 2026, at a CAGR of 5.00% to reach USD 662.20 million by 2032.

Discover how evolving protective packaging and digital imaging convergence is reshaping the trajectory of the global X-ray envelope market with fresh insights

Discover how the intersection of protective packaging and modern imaging technologies is driving a profound evolution in the X-ray envelope market. As healthcare providers continue to embrace digital radiography systems, which now account for roughly 70% of installations globally, demand for specialized envelopes that accommodate new detector formats and deliver reliable film protection is transforming conventional packaging strategies and supplier ecosystems.

Simultaneously, the packaging landscape is being reshaped by a growing mandate for sustainability and precision engineering. Packaging designers are pioneering mono-material structures and recycle-ready formats that streamline post-use recycling and minimize environmental impact while preserving barrier performance essential for medical integrity. Transitioning from multi-component assemblies to single-material constructions not only simplifies supply chains but also resonates with healthcare systems prioritizing circular economy principles and regulatory compliance.

Uncover the seismic shifts in materials innovation digital adoption and sustainability practices redefining dynamics within the X-ray envelope landscape

The rapid adoption of cloud-enabled and AI-integrated radiography platforms is redefining envelope design requirements at unprecedented speed. Advanced flat-panel detectors, now prevalent in direct radiography systems, demand lighter yet more dimensionally precise envelopes that facilitate seamless integration into digital workflows and enable remote access capabilities for telemedicine applications. In parallel, AI-driven quality control in packaging production lines accelerates defect detection, empowering manufacturers to uphold stringent performance standards with minimal waste.

Concurrently, the industry is witnessing a shift toward custom, on-demand manufacturing models fueled by 3D printing and digital prototyping technologies. These innovations allow for rapid iteration of envelope geometries to serve niche applications, ranging from veterinary imaging modules to portable industrial X-ray systems. Alongside customization, sustainable material exploration is intensifying, as the use of bio-based coatings and eco-friendly inks reduces carbon footprints while adhering to the sterility and barrier requirements of medical-grade packaging.

Explore how the cascade of United States tariffs and evolving trade policies through 2025 has reshaped raw material sourcing costs for X-ray envelopes

In 2025, the United States implemented sweeping tariff measures that introduced a baseline 10% duty on imported goods alongside reciprocal duties of up to 30% on key categories of packaging materials, including polymer films and paper substrates. These escalations, enacted without exemption for traditional envelope components, have significantly elevated landed costs for manufacturers reliant on offshore supply chains.

Tariffs applied under revised Section 301 and IEEPA directives have driven the total burden on plastic films and containers to nearly 50%, with Harmonized System codes for film sheets now subject to combined base and supplemental duties as high as 50%. This sharp increase not only pressures raw material procurement budgets but also cascades through multiple tiers of the supply chain, compelling organizations to absorb additional costs, negotiate pricing adjustments, or pursue design simplifications to preserve margin integrity.

Delve into nuanced segmentation insights uncovering how material type technology end user and application differentiate demand patterns in the X-ray envelope sector

Examining envelope materials reveals that traditional film-based substrates, once the linchpin of X-ray protection, are yielding ground to polyester alternatives prized for their superior tear strength, dimensional stability, and compatibility with automated processing systems. Paper-based formats maintain relevance through their enhanced recyclability and emerging monomaterial laminates that combine renewable fibers with high-barrier coatings. The ongoing sustainability imperative is accelerating uptake of recyclable polyethylene terephthalate and high-density polyethylene variants engineered for medical compliance.

From a technological standpoint, direct radiography envelopes dominate the market landscape, as providers worldwide gravitate toward flat-panel detector systems that now constitute over 83% of modern digital X-ray installations. Computed radiography products remain vital for legacy infrastructure, while screen film radiography envelopes persist in specialized contexts where digital conversion has yet to fully penetrate. Hospitals, representing more than 57% of end-user demand, require envelope solutions tailored for high-throughput imaging suites, while outpatient clinics and diagnostic centers emphasize cost-effective disposability. Veterinary and industrial applications round out the spectrum, each segment driving specific performance trade-offs in envelope design.

Examine the distinct regional dynamics across Americas EMEA and Asia Pacific revealing unique growth drivers regulatory landscapes and supply chain considerations for X-ray envelopes

In the Americas, the United States and Canada spearhead demand for advanced X-ray envelope products, buoyed by robust healthcare infrastructure, stringent regulatory frameworks, and localized production strategies that mitigate tariff exposure. North America’s dominance of approximately 38.5% in digital radiography underscores the region’s emphasis on high-performance barrier films and rapid supply chain responsiveness.

Across Europe Middle East & Africa, diverse regulatory landscapes-from the EU’s circular economy directives to Gulf health authority mandates-have fostered differentiated requirements for envelope recyclability, labeling traceability, and sterilization integrity. Meanwhile, Asia-Pacific is emerging as the fastest-growing region, propelled by rising healthcare expenditure in China India and Southeast Asia, expanding domestic manufacturing capacity, and an 8.9% projected CAGR that highlights appetite for cost-optimized polyester and paper envelope formats tailored to regional imaging modalities.

Gain clarity on the competitive intensity and strategic positioning of leading players shaping innovation quality and supply chain resilience in the X-ray envelope market

Competitive pressure in the X-ray envelope market is intensifying as established imaging and packaging leaders vie for technological leadership and supply chain resilience. Agfa-Gevaert, Canon, GE Healthcare, Fujifilm, Koninklijke Philips, and Siemens Healthineers have fortified their portfolios through strategic collaborations and in-house innovation teams dedicated to next-generation envelope substrates optimized for direct-drill flat-panel detectors and AI-enabled imaging modules.

These global players are also investing heavily in regional manufacturing expansions and digital quality management systems to ensure consistent product performance under tight lead-time constraints. Emphasis on barrier efficacy against humidity and oxygen ingress has driven development of multi-layer monomaterial laminates, while integrated RFID tagging and tamper-evident features address growing demand for real-time traceability and patient safety assurance.
